Help Desire HD in a crashing loop

Hello i'm new to this forum and in urgent need of help and advice from the community.

My desire HD keeps crashing in a loop with force closes for something called googleframework and it's rendered my phone unusable. I have completed a factory reset which does not fix the issue and I have formatted the SD card as well to make sure there was no apps which was causing this issue.
my phone is operating on a UK T-mobile firmware with the following build and build versions as shown below

Android version - 2.3.3
HTC Sense version - 2.1
Baseband version - 15.54.60.25U_26.09.04.11_M2
Kernel Version - 2.6.35.10-g3bf3222
htc-kernel@and18-2 #1
Mon apr 11:22:46:37 CST 2011
Build number - 2.37.110.5
Browser version - WebKit.533.1

I tried to see if there was any updates but according to the phone it's up to date so I am at a lose into why my phone is crashing all the time.

Hi I have exact problem had my desire HD for 2weeks now and have always encounted problems from day1. However after restless nights of sleep researching for a fix there's more info on the extent of the problems then there is a solution...

I have however fixed the prob with the app "HTC SENSE" not responding, or stopped suddenly causing me to wait, tell HTC, or force stop!

Go to> settings> accounts and sync> enable both bakground and sync all.

You may need to setup HTC sense account before syncing.

This is a solution that works its easy as 1...... 2......... 3!!!
I hope I helped because we all seem to have the same problem and this worked for me now phones working better then it did brand new and its running gingerbread 2.3
No need to hard reset or download other apps n fixes! This will work and if it doesn't keep trying because your phones only trying to connect to HTC sense, which controls the phone.. whatever u do u must make sure HTC sense is enabled to sync at all times while phone is on!
You also need to make site HTC sense update schedule is set to "as items change".
